Slow Cooker Saucy Meatballs

How to make it
- COMBINE stuffing mix, meat, egg and water. Shape into 1-inch balls. Place in slow cooker; top with mushrooms, peppers and spaghetti sauce. Cover with lid.
- COOK on LOW for 6 to 8 hours (or on for HIGH 3 to 4 hours).
- COOK spaghetti as directed on package; drain. Serve meatballs with sauce over spaghetti. Sprinkle with cheese.
- Note: As with any dish you make if there is to much grease spoon it off or blot it out. If you need a little touch of seasoning then add it to your taste. This is a good little recipe; get creative and add zucchini or your favorite veggie.
